About Converting Picograms per Quart to Ounces per Milliliter
Picogram per Quart and Ounce per Milliliter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
ounces per milliliter = picograms per quart × 3.727358e-17
This factor comes from each unit's defined relationship to the category's base unit: 1 picogram per quart equals 1.056688e-12 base units, and 1 ounce per milliliter equals 28349.523125 base units, so dividing one by the other gives the direct picogram per quart-to-ounce per milliliter factor of 3.727358e-17.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
